Gear for Good: Pre-Loved Snowsport Pop-Up by Iglu Ski

Pop-Up Event: Saturday 13th December | 10am – 4pm
Donations Accepted: 9th – 12th December
Our newest office tenants, Iglu Ski, are bringing a fantastic community event to Wimbledon Quarter. Gear for Good is a one-day pop-up event on Saturday 13th December 2025 between 1am – 4pm, where you can shop pre-loved snowsport clothing and equipment just in time for the winter season, all in support of Disability Snowsport UK (DSUK).
Browse a huge selection of quality donated items, including:
- Skis, snowboards & boots
- Jackets, pants, gloves & goggles
- Backpacks & accessories
Every penny raised goes directly to DSUK, helping provide adaptive snowsports opportunities to people across the UK. By picking up a pre-loved gem, you’re helping make the slopes more inclusive for everyone, regardless of ability.
Donate Your Pre-Loved Gear (9th–12th December)
If you would like to donate any items to this very worthy cause, you can drop them off at Wimbledon Quarter’s ice rink ahead of the event.
Got unused ski or snowboard gear at home? Give it a second life and help transform someone’s experience on the mountain. We’re accepting:
- Skis, snowboards & boots
- Jackets, pants, gloves & goggles
- Helmets, backpacks & accessories
All donated items must be suitable for resale and 100% of proceeds support DSUK.
Items We Cannot Accept
To maintain quality and safety, please do not donate:
- Used helmets
- Old-style “skinny” downhill skis (cross-country skis are accepted)
- Items that are dirty, have holes or rips
- Boots or clothing with unpleasant odours
- Boots with heavily worn toes, heels or base plates
- Skis with loose bindings or cracked edges
